Tips to Esign Legal Texas Releases Forms For Free

  1. Ensure the document content is accurate and complete before signing.
  2. Use a secure platform that is compliant with Texas eSignature laws.
  3. Verify the identity of all parties involved in the signing process.
  4. Clearly indicate where each party needs to sign or initial on the form.
  5. Provide instructions on how to sign electronically for those unfamiliar with the process.

Editing features for Esign Legal Texas Releases Forms may be needed when there are errors in the document content or if additional information needs to be added before the form is signed.
